What Defines an Affordable KitchenAid Dishwasher?

An affordable KitchenAid dishwasher is defined by its price point, features, and efficiency.

  1. Price Range: Affordable models usually cost between $600 – $800.
  2. Essential Features: Core functionalities such as multiple wash cycles and energy efficiency.
  3. Energy Efficiency Rating: Models with a minimum Energy Star rating.
  4. Size and Capacity: Standard dimensions suitable for most kitchens, typically accommodating 12-16 place settings.
  5. Noise Level: Dishwashers with lower decibel ratings, ideally under 50 dB.
  6. Build Quality: Durable materials such as stainless steel for longevity.

Transitioning to a more in-depth examination, let’s define and elaborate on each attribute that contributes to an affordable KitchenAid dishwasher.

  1. Price Range:
    An affordable KitchenAid dishwasher is characterized by a price range between $600 and $800. This pricing makes it accessible for middle-income consumers seeking good quality without a hefty investment. According to a market analysis by Consumer Reports, models within this range offer a balance of performance and affordability, making them popular options.

  2. Essential Features:
    Essential features include key functionalities like multiple wash cycles, adjustable racks, and a delay start option. These functionalities enhance user convenience and adaptability. For instance, models with cycle options, such as quick wash or heavy-duty, cater to varying user needs. A comparison by Reviewed.com shows that these features significantly improve user satisfaction, as they allow for customized dishwashing experiences.

  3. Energy Efficiency Rating:
    Energy efficiency is critical for affordability. An affordable KitchenAid dishwasher should ideally have at least an Energy Star rating. This rating indicates reduced energy consumption, which leads to lower utility bills. The U.S. Department of Energy states that appliances with Energy Star labels can save consumers approximately 30% on energy costs compared to non-rated models.

  4. Size and Capacity:
    Size and capacity are important for kitchen compatibility. Most affordable KitchenAid dishwashers are designed to fit standard kitchen spaces and hold between 12 to 16 place settings. This capacity is suitable for average households. According to Kitchen & Bath Design News, the standard size accommodates the needs of most families while providing adequate space for larger loads.

  5. Noise Level:
    A lower noise level enhances the user experience, making it more pleasant to operate in an open-plan kitchen. An affordable KitchenAid dishwasher ideally operates under 50 dB, which is considered quietly efficient. The National Association of Home Builders suggests that quieter models are increasingly becoming a priority for consumers as they seek appliances that do not disrupt household activities.

  6. Build Quality:
    The build quality of an affordable KitchenAid dishwasher typically features durable materials such as stainless steel, which is resistant to rust and easy to clean. This durability ensures longevity and reduces the need for frequent replacements. A report from the Association of Home Appliance Manufacturers highlights that sturdily built appliances can last over a decade, offering long-term value even at an affordable price.

What Wash Cycles Are Available in Affordable KitchenAid Models?

Affordable KitchenAid models typically offer several wash cycles to cater to various cleaning needs.

  1. Normal Wash Cycle
  2. Heavy Duty Wash Cycle
  3. Light Wash Cycle
  4. Quick Wash Cycle
  5. Rinse Only Cycle
  6. Eco Wash Cycle

While each cycle serves specific washing purposes, consumer reviews highlight that some users prefer additional features such as sanitize options or specialized cycles for pots and pans. This leads to an exploration of how each wash cycle differs in terms of effectiveness and efficiency.

  1. Normal Wash Cycle: The Normal Wash Cycle is designed for everyday dish cleaning. It provides a balanced approach by effectively removing food residues without excessive water usage. This cycle is ideal for moderately soiled dishes and runs for about two hours.

  2. Heavy Duty Wash Cycle: The Heavy Duty Wash Cycle is specifically engineered for tougher cleaning tasks, such as pots, pans, and heavily soiled items. This cycle uses higher temperatures and increased water pressure to ensure thorough cleaning. It usually lasts longer than the normal cycle, often exceeding two and a half hours.

  3. Light Wash Cycle: The Light Wash Cycle is suitable for gently soiled dishes, such as glassware and lightly used utensils. This cycle uses less water and energy, making it an ideal choice for conserving resources. It generally has a shorter duration, typically around one hour.

  4. Quick Wash Cycle: The Quick Wash Cycle allows for faster cleaning of dishes. This cycle is effective for lightly soiled items and can complete a wash in as little as 30 minutes. It is useful for situations where time is of the essence.

  5. Rinse Only Cycle: The Rinse Only Cycle is designed to rinse off stuck-on food from dishes that will be washed later. It uses minimal water and offers a short duration to prevent food from hardening on the dishes.

  6. Eco Wash Cycle: The Eco Wash Cycle promotes water and energy efficiency. It uses lower temperatures and longer wash times to reduce resource consumption while still providing satisfactory cleaning. This option is ideal for environmentally conscious consumers seeking to minimize their ecological footprint.
